2021KO36      Phys.Lett. B 822, 136652 (2021)

J.Kostensalo, J.Suhonen, J.Volkmer, S.Zatschler, K.Zuber

Confirmation of gA quenching using the revised spectrum-shape method for the analysis of the 113Cd β-decay as measured with the COBRA demonstrator

RADIOACTIVITY 113Cd(β-); analyzed available data; deduced evaluated β-spectrum, significantly quenched values of the axial-vector coupling for all three nuclear models.

2020BO01      Phys.Lett. B 800, 135092 (2020)

L.Bodenstein-Dresler, Y.Chu, D.Gehre, C.Gossling, A.Heimbold, C.Herrmann, R.Hodak, J.Kostensalo, K.Kroninger, J.Kuttler, C.Nitsch, T.Quante, E.Rukhadze, I.Stekl, J.Suhonen, J.Tebrugge, R.Temminghoff, J.Volkmer, S.Zatschler, K.Zuber

Quenching of gA deduced from the β-spectrum shape of 113Cd measured with the COBRA experiment

RADIOACTIVITY 113Cd(β-); measured decay products, Eβ, Iβ; deduced β-spectrum shape, quenching of the weak axial-vector coupling strength.
